Zoom Workplace Gains New Momentum With BrightHire Integration

The Brief: Zoom announced the acquisition of BrightHire, a platform designed to enhance hiring workflows through AI-supported interview intelligence. The deal brings BrightHire’s recording, transcription, and structured evaluation capabilities into Zoom Workplace, expanding the platform’s reach deeper into talent acquisition processes. According to the announcement, BrightHire’s tools will be integrated to help organizations create consistent interview experiences, improve collaboration among hiring teams, and streamline decision-making. The acquisition continues Zoom’s broader strategy of incorporating advanced AI features across its product ecosystem, supporting users who manage internal communications, meetings, and team-based workflows through Zoom Workplace. Initial details outline plans to bring BrightHire’s capabilities into Zoom’s unified interface.

Zoom’s Expansion Into AI-Enhanced Hiring Workflows

The acquisition extends Zoom Workplace into a critical area of HR operations: interview management. BrightHire’s platform records interviews, generates transcripts, and supports structured scoring, allowing hiring teams to organize their evaluations within a single system. These capabilities align with the increasing need for standardized interview processes as organizations continue hiring in remote and hybrid environments. The integration provides users with tools that simplify how interviews are conducted, reviewed, and shared internally. Through bringing BrightHire technology into Zoom Workplace, users gain a more connected workflow that reduces reliance on multiple systems during talent assessments. The move also supports broader organizational efforts to improve hiring consistency through accessible insights captured directly within virtual meeting environments.
